Home
last modified time | relevance | path

Searched refs:uncacheBuffer (Results 1 – 4 of 4) sorted by relevance

/frameworks/native/libs/gui/
DISurfaceComposer.cpp91 for (const client_cache_t& uncacheBuffer : uncacheBuffers) { in setTransactionState() local
92 SAFE_PARCEL(data.writeStrongBinder, uncacheBuffer.token.promote()); in setTransactionState()
93 SAFE_PARCEL(data.writeUint64, uncacheBuffer.id); in setTransactionState()
DSurfaceComposerClient.cpp920 for (const client_cache_t& uncacheBuffer : mUncacheBuffers) { in writeToParcel() local
921 SAFE_PARCEL(parcel->writeStrongBinder, uncacheBuffer.token.promote()); in writeToParcel()
922 SAFE_PARCEL(parcel->writeUint64, uncacheBuffer.id); in writeToParcel()
1058 client_cache_t uncacheBuffer; in doUncacheBufferTransaction() local
1059 uncacheBuffer.token = BufferCache::getInstance().getToken(); in doUncacheBufferTransaction()
1060 uncacheBuffer.id = cacheId; in doUncacheBufferTransaction()
1065 true, {uncacheBuffer}, false, {}, generateId(), {}); in doUncacheBufferTransaction()
1103 std::optional<client_cache_t> uncacheBuffer; in cacheBuffers() local
1104 cacheId = BufferCache::getInstance().cache(s->bufferData->buffer, uncacheBuffer); in cacheBuffers()
1105 if (uncacheBuffer) { in cacheBuffers()
[all …]
/frameworks/native/libs/gui/include/gui/
DISurfaceComposer.h117 bool isAutoTimestamp, const std::vector<client_cache_t>& uncacheBuffer,
/frameworks/native/services/surfaceflinger/
DSurfaceFlinger.cpp5225 for (const auto& uncacheBuffer : uncacheBuffers) { in setTransactionState() local
5226 sp<GraphicBuffer> buffer = ClientCache::getInstance().erase(uncacheBuffer); in setTransactionState()